Global Antitrust Regulations: A Complex Landscape for Mergers and Acquisitions
The global landscape of antitrust regulations presents unique challenges for healthcare professionals involved in mergers and acquisitions (M&A). As organizations expand across borders, they must navigate a complex web of laws designed to prevent anti-competitive practices that could harm consumers and stifle economic growth. These Global Antitrust Regulations vary significantly from country to country, making it crucial for healthcare compliance experts to stay informed about the specific rules in each market they operate in.
Cross-border M&A deals can quickly run afoul of antitrust laws if not properly structured. Expertise in understanding market definitions, assessing competitive impacts, and identifying potential red flags is essential throughout all stages of the investigative and enforcement process. Healthcare professionals must be adept at analyzing transaction structures, market data, and industry dynamics to ensure compliance with both host country regulations and international standards. This meticulous approach not only mitigates legal risks but also ensures fair competition and protects patients’ interests in a globalized healthcare sector.
